阿里云-云小站(无限量代金券发放中)
【腾讯云】云服务器、云数据库、COS、CDN、短信等热卖云产品特惠抢购

Oracle 118C 版本发布策略的变更

208次阅读
没有评论

共计 1473 个字符,预计需要花费 4 分钟才能阅读完成。

18C 之前的版本标识

Oracle 的版本发布和补丁策略一直没有太大的调整,基本保持 3 - 4 年一个大版本,两代产品之间会出一个 Release 2。这种策略的好处是能够保证系统的稳定性,一个新的大部分更新到 Release 2 时,基本被认为是比较稳定的版本,保守的用户一般会选择这个版本进行升级。

Oracle 118C 版本发布策略的变更

Oracle 12.2 之前的版本标识图

Major Database Release Number

第一个数字是最一般的标识符。它代表了包含重要新功能的软件的主要新版本

Database Maintenance Release Number

第二个数字代表维护版本级别。一些新功能也可能包括在内。

Fusion Middleware Release Number

第三个数字反映了 Oracle 融合中间件的发布级别

Component-Specific Release Number

第四个数字标识特定于组件的发布级别。例如,取决于组件补丁集或临时版本,不同的组件在这个位置可以具有不同的编号。

Platform-Specific Release Number

第五个数字标识特定于平台的版本。通常这是一个补丁集。当不同的平台需要相同的补丁集时,这个数字在受影响的平台上将是相同的。

18C 之后的版本标识

从 2017 年 7 月开始,Oracle 改变了以往的数据库软件发布流程,采用年度 Release 和季度更新的策略。

Yearly Release

将之前的 N 年一发布更改为每年一发布。每年发布的策略能够将更多的新功能更快的提供给用户,同时也大大减少了单次软件变更的数量,避免大的版本升级对系统产生的风险。

Quarterly Release Update

Oracle 会在每年 1 /4/7/10 月提供季度发布更新。季度更新主要包含查询优化器相关 BUG 和安全漏洞的修复等。

Release Update Revisions

除季度更新之外,发布更新修订也将按季度发布,基于上一个 RU 的缺陷进行修复,并包含最新的安全漏洞补丁。

每个季度更新发布之后的六个月内,最多有两个独立的更新修订(RUR)。例如,Release.Update.1 和 Release.Update.2,其中“1”和“2”代表版本迭代。

新的年度 Release 发布后的至少两年内,都会提供 RU 的支持,每个 RU 又会提供两个独立的 RUR 支持。因此每个年度 Release 至少会有 3 年的更新支持周期。

基于上述的策略,新的 Oracle 数据库版本号主要由三位数组成 – release.update.revision。

Release 是发布年份的后两位数字,比如最新发布的 18c,表示该版本发布于 2018 年

Update 表示 RU 或者测试版本,发布于第一个季度为 1,之后每个季度加 1

Revision 表示 RUR 版本,基于某个 RU 的修订,每个 RU 最多两个 RUR

PS:我们现在看到的版本号可能仍然是 5 位的,第 4 位是 Oracle 数据库的增量版本,偶尔会用于 Oracle 云数据库中,第 5 位是保留位,预留给将来。对于大多数用户来说,只需要关注前 3 位。

Oracle 118C 版本发布策略的变更

Oracle 18c 版本标识

其他

Oracle 新的策略发布频率明显加快,能够更快的推出新功能。

当前的数据库市场竞争非常的激烈,熟悉开源数据库的同学可能已经看出,Oracle 的版本策略已经逐步在向开源数据库靠拢。之前的那种 3 - 4 年一个大版本已经很难再跟上开源产品快速迭代的步伐,所以个人认为,这即是一个技术上的调整,更是一个商业上的调整。

更多 Oracle 相关信息见 Oracle 专题页面 https://www.linuxidc.com/topicnews.aspx?tid=12

正文完
星哥玩云-微信公众号
post-qrcode
 0
星锅
版权声明:本站原创文章,由 星锅 于2022-01-22发表,共计1473字。
转载说明:除特殊说明外本站文章皆由CC-4.0协议发布,转载请注明出处。
【腾讯云】推广者专属福利,新客户无门槛领取总价值高达2860元代金券,每种代金券限量500张,先到先得。
阿里云-最新活动爆款每日限量供应
评论(没有评论)
验证码
【腾讯云】云服务器、云数据库、COS、CDN、短信等云产品特惠热卖中